On editing .... While I'm still raw at it also... I agree with meifesto ... Shorter ... I have been trying real hard to stay under 10 min ... And closer to 5-7 min if I can.. Not that my view count is climbing off the charts yet... Or even off the floor!

I usually end up trash about 50% of a vid in the first pass.... Cut out the 'nothing chatter' .. The straight nothing happening bits of road/traffic ... The bad 'takes' of what I'm trying to say ..

On the second pass I look to tidy up the flow of my chosen viewpoint/topics and setup neater vision cuts , make sure I'm not leaving the rest of the side chatter in the way of the main ideas ... And lose maybe another 10-20% of it ...

Then it's down to the particular splits start/end points ... Add in the effects ... Fade in from black, fade out... Swirls, pixellated frame etc ...

Cut about 30 min down to roughly 10 .... Then play the whole thing through and see if I make a face at anything I did or said that's still there... Working on nearly an hour of stuff at the moment ... It's all kinda linked but looks like it gonna be better in the end to do Part 1 and Part 2 .... Simply to keep the length bearable ... ;)

I don't save any of the trashed stuff ..apart from any out-takes I really want .. 5-10 second grabs of oopses and brainfarts ..I figure I can always cover it again in another run.... And if I didn't like the stuff enough to keep it in first edit then I'm unlikely to want it later.... You can save everything I guess. ... But you gonna need a tB storage drive pretty soon!

Most of my videos result from a ride that lasted 3-4 hours so I have to be really picky what I put in to keep the length down :P In my experience, if it feels like you've been talking too long, chances are you have been. 3-5 minutes flies by on a bike, so from where you start, think how far you can go in that time and try and get everything you want to say on camera before you get there. That's what I do anyway.
